Jade Mia Broadhead reviews the debut album release from the Eurovision artist
Released: 15.09.23
Eurovision was cruel on Mae Muller and her catchy disco pop track I Wrote A Song deserved better.
It features here as the fourth track of sixteen, after a largely forgettable first three. And therein lies the problem. There’s a good album here, but you have to wade through too much filler to find it. Porn Lied To Us contains an important message about the dangers of instant gratification to a budding relationship whilst MTJL is an intimate confessional ballad about insecurity, but for every decent pop song there’s another like Little Bit Sad that doesn’t quite hit the mark.
Sorry I’m Late claims Mae’s debut, but if she’s to put Eurovision behind her, she needs more quality than quantity.
